Southern Yellow-Winged Grasshopper - Arphia granulata - male

Southern Yellow-Winged Grasshopper - Arphia granulata - Male
Palm Beach Gardens, Florida, USA
June 26, 2004
These make a lot of noise (crepitate) while flying. The bright yellow hind-wings are very distinctive. This photo was taken at the Frenchman's Forest Natural Area.
